 Description   

Once 10.3 is merged, test the major oracle compatibility features and validate what works / does not work and file tickets for what does not work - we will prioritze and fix low hanging fruit. Most stored procedure logic is likely problematic.

A good starting point for changes is this article:

Comment by Daniel Lee (Inactive) [ 2018-10-01 ]

Created the features/oracleCompatibility test suite, which consists of 76 test cases at the moment. I execute the test suite on the latest build ColumnStore 1.2.0-1. Two bugs have been identified and tickets have been created.

MCOL-1751 Oracle Compatibility: SELECT IF (...) INTO variable FROM DUAL result in syntax error
MCOL-1752 Oracle Compatibility: A specific stored procedure caused mysqld to crash
